Output a3a89463e30604aead13f7fa2371370b8da12cb3ff14cf16d91e0d333626427a:1

value
2900000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 be6ea75089158c179aa9d8436d472f2cc0705595 OP_EQUALVERIFY OP_CHECKSIG
address
1JMuwnyx7ZRHWCHgUVH6x4YVE8CkTkvpMU
transaction
a3a89463e30604aead13f7fa2371370b8da12cb3ff14cf16d91e0d333626427a
spent
true